Output efaa256efb66defb44a24a99b78584fd63ccf6d5151c4cd6d171cc5cd422eed3:0

value
91964500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a39e2fc85fdf2047f4fa7c372161facae025bb9e OP_EQUAL
address
MNpHshYEwfWWRQGpRiUo8c3hnzDEcmYhTe
transaction
efaa256efb66defb44a24a99b78584fd63ccf6d5151c4cd6d171cc5cd422eed3
spent
true